摘要
In this paper, we propose a new control algorithm of a power assisted cycle which is an electrical cycle driven by a human's pedaling force and an actuator's driving force. In this algorithm, an actuator's driving force is generated based on the pedaling torque of the rider and environmental conditions, so that the rider could ride the cycle on any road as if he/she rides on a horizontal road. In addition, this control algorithm could adjust apparent resistance forces for riding the cycle depending on rider's physical strength. The proposed control algorithm is experimentally applied to an electrical tricycle and the experimental results illustrate the validity of the proposed algorithm.
